Urusvati Museum of Folklore
Village - Shikohpu, NH 8, District Gurgaon, Haryana

We take pleasure in introducing you, the Urusvati Museum of Folklore located at "Madhram", Village,Shilkopur, N.H.8, Gurgaon, under the auspices of Urusvati Centre of Contemporary Arts and The Ford Foundation, New Delhi.

The museum is located amidst a Jasmine Garden and spread over five and half acre of lush greenery with the Aravalli Mountain Range forming a majestic backdrop. It is approximately 10 kilometers away from Hero Honda chowk on the way to Jaipur. This is the only Museum of it kind, which showcases the legendry love stories of country through trans-lights, dioramas, painting, prints and sculptures. 

It has also displayed the folk art and crafts along with costumes, jewellries, folk musical instruments and potteries etc. The museum also has  a souvenir shop, cafeteria and terracotta garden.

Since the Museum is on the way to Jaipur and represents the vast cultural heritage of the country; it is  a great attraction for the tourists, where they can stop for fifteen minutes to relax and see the Museum. A contribution charge of Rs. 25/- per person will be charged from the visitors. The Museum has ample parking space, which can easily accommodate three to four buses.
